Paint protection film (PPF) is a clear urethane film designed to protect painted surfaces from rock chips, road debris, bug acids, scratches, and environmental damage while remaining virtually invisible once installed.

What is precut paint protection film?
What is precut paint protection film?
Precut paint protection film is a clear protective polyurethane film that is computer-cut to match specific vehicle panels. These kits are designed for accurate fitment and allow installers or DIY customers to install paint protection film without cutting directly on the vehicle.
The film protects painted surfaces from rock chips, road debris, bug acids, and minor scratches while remaining nearly invisible once installed.
Paint protection film can be safely removed in the future without harming the factory paint, and with proper care it can last for many years.
Are PPF kits difficult to install?
Are PPF kits difficult to install?
Precut paint protection film kits are designed to make installation easier by providing pieces that are already cut to match your vehicle. This eliminates the need to cut film on the car and helps reduce installation errors.
Although some experience and patience are helpful, many DIY customers are able to achieve great results by carefully following installation instructions.
Which paint protection film should I choose?
Which paint protection film should I choose?
The best paint protection film for your vehicle depends on your priorities, such as protection level, gloss finish, hydrophobic performance, and budget. Most modern paint protection films provide strong protection against rock chips, scratches, and road debris, but different films offer unique features.
For example:
• Standard 8 Mil films offer excellent protection and are a great option for most daily drivers.
• 10 Mil films provide thicker material for increased protection against road debris and highway driving.
• Hydrophobic films repel water, dirt, and contaminants, making the vehicle easier to clean.
• Matte or satin films protect the paint while maintaining or creating a matte appearance.
Most premium paint protection films also include self-healing technology, which allows minor scratches or swirl marks to disappear with heat.

Are installation tools included?
Are installation tools included?
Installation tools are not included with our precut paint protection film kits. Most professional installers and DIY customers already have the tools needed for installation.
If you need the required tools, they can be purchased separately from our store or sourced locally.
We also provide online installation instructions and video tutorials to help guide you through the installation process.
The basic tools typically required for installation include:
• Spray bottles for slip and tack solutions
• A rubber squeegee
• A precision knife or blade
• Microfiber towels
These tools can easily be purchased separately if needed.

How the Material Is Cut, Unpacked, and Shipped
The material is cut on large sheets to help keep costs lower for the customer. It is typically laid out on 60″ or 30″ wide sheets, and you will receive a confirmation showing how everything is arranged when your order is processed.
Your order will be rolled and shipped in a protective core tube to prevent damage during transit.
To separate the pieces, simply unroll the material on a clean table or floor and use scissors to cut out each individual piece before installation. For easier handling, you can also use foldable tables, like picnic tables, to lay everything out while working.
